We may also aggregate or otherwise strip data of all personally identifying characteristics and may share that aggregated, anonymized data with third parties.</p> Ads on Disqus <p>We may also share certain information such as your location, browser and cookie data and other data relating to your use of our Service with our business partners to deliver advertisements (“ads”) that may be of interest to you.
Disqus may allow third-party ad servers or ad networks to serve advertisements on the Service.
These third-party ad servers or ad networks use technology to send, directly to your browser or mobile device, the ads and ad links that appear on the Service, and will automatically receive your IP address when they do so.
They may also use other technologies (such as cookies, JavaScript, device identifiers, location data, and clear gifs, see above) to compile information about your browser’s or device’s visits and usage patterns on the Service, and to measure the effectiveness of their ads and to personalize the advertising content.
Disqus does not sell, rent, or share the information we collect directly from you or about you from third parties with these third-party ad servers or ad networks for such parties’ own marketing purposes.</p>

<p>Please note that an advertiser may ask Disqus to show an ad to a certain audience of Users (e.g., based on demographics or other interests).
In that situation, Disqus determines the target audience and Disqus serves the advertising to that audience and only provides anonymous aggregated data to the advertiser.
If you respond to such an ad, the advertiser or ad server may conclude that you fit the description of the audience they are trying to reach.</p>
<p>The Disqus Privacy Policy does not apply to, and we cannot control the activities of, third-party advertisers.

<p>For all users, we believe more relevant advertising generally improves user experience, however we recognize and support the preference to opt out of collecting Non-Personally Identifiable Information about your website visits for the purpose of delivering targeted advertising.
Users can do so at http://disqus.com/optout.
When you opt out, we will place an opt-out cookie on your computer.
Please note that if you block cookies, our opt-out process may not function properly.
Please also note that if you delete, block, or otherwise restrict cookies, or if you use a different computer or Internet browser, you will need to renew your opt-out choice.
Website owners using Disqus may also opt out of Disqus using Non-Personally Identifiable Information from pages using Disqus for the purpose of targeted advertising at https://disqus.com/admin/settings/advanced/.</p>
